How One UM Student’s Heartfelt Letter Sparked a Campus Movement
A Grateful Cane’s Emotional Tribute Goes Viral
When University of Miami senior Emily Rodriguez sat down to write a thank-you letter to the professor who changed her life, she never expected her words would inspire an entire campus movement. What began as a private note of appreciation has evolved into "With Love From a Cane," a viral initiative encouraging students to express gratitude before graduation.
The Ripple Effect of One Simple Letter
Rodriguez's original letter, penned after an especially impactful semester with Dr. Marcus Chen in the Psychology Department, contained these powerful words:
- "You saw potential in me when I doubted myself"
- "Your office hours became my safe space during tough times"
- "This university feels like home because of mentors like you"
How the Movement Took Flight
Within days of Rodriguez sharing her letter on social media:
- Over 200 students submitted handwritten notes to faculty
- The Student Government Association launched a campus-wide letter-writing campaign
- University administrators allocated funds for special "Gratitude Stationery"
